The Tomcat plugin has a fairly amazing dependency chain to resolve :-)
Right now, I'm trying to get the jasper plugin to build, and I'm
having some bundle resolution issues. The Jasper plugin pulls in
org.eclipse.jdt.core bundle (which IS a bundle already). That
bundle has required bundle dependencies declared for a number of
other eclipse runtime bundles in org.eclipse.core (resources,
runtime, etc). Unfortunately, these dependencies don't appear to be
in any of the maven repositories we're using for the builds, so I
can't seem to resolve these. In previous releases, we had
exclusions defined for those jars, but since this jar is now loading
as a bundle, the internal constraints are kicking in preventing the
bundle from starting.
